Uploaded image for project: 'CDI Specification Issues'
  1. CDI Specification Issues
  2. CDI-377

automatic JSR-330 annotation processing problematic

    XMLWordPrintable

    Details

      Description

      The jsr-330 dependency injection annotations (javax.inject.*) find use in javase environments using IOC packages like guice.
      Adding a dependency on a jar that uses guice or whatever in a javase environment
      to a war deployed to a jee7 container
      results in CDI processing annotated classes intended for
      app-managed injection. See this ticket filed with guava for a concrete example:
      https://code.google.com/p/guava-libraries/issues/detail?id=1433

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              antoinesabot-durand Antoine Sabot-Durand (Inactive)
              Reporter:
              frickjack Reuben Pasquini (Inactive)
              Votes:
              3 Vote for this issue
              Watchers:
              15 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: